我从Xero RequestToken
端点收到一个非常奇怪的错误。
oauth_problem=consumer_key_unknown&oauth_problem_advice=Unknown Consumer (Realm: , Key: )
我知道所提供的使用者密钥是正确的,并且已经验证了Authentication: OAuth
标头是正确的,并且已经通过一些不同的OAuth实现来验证了签名。如果我获得了一些已知的访问令牌,我的实现可以调用数据端点,而不能调用令牌端点。
有人能说清楚吗?我猜Realm:
是因为我没有指定领域,但Xero SDK都没有。
答案 0 :(得分:1)
我也面临同样的问题。与支持团队联系后,我得到了此问题的原因,如果消费者密钥正确,则可能会发生此错误,因为签名未正确生成。